Output 52fedebdc864cf8f47e319eaf88bfffd2105c76d5bae298e7ceec275a9702a5d:2

value
66955417
script pubkey
OP_0 OP_PUSHBYTES_32 c693d7a9e687a983c65c311895b820fc256ed29027faa785755739af30b46f58
address
bc1qc6fa020xs75c83juxyvftwpqlsjka55syla20pt42uu67v95davqe4p350
transaction
52fedebdc864cf8f47e319eaf88bfffd2105c76d5bae298e7ceec275a9702a5d